Warning: Keep a safe distance

from the machine when operat- ing. Switch off and remove plug from mains before adjusting, cleaning or if the cable is entan- gled and before leaving the gar- den product unattended for any period. Keep the supply flexible cord away from the cutting line. Wear eye and ear protection. Do not work in the rain or leave the trimmer outdoors whilst it is raining. Beware of thrown or flying objects to bystanders.

Warning: Keep a safe distance from the

machine when operating. Operation Never allow children or people unfa- miliar with these instructions to use the machine. Local regulations may restrict the age of the operator. When not in use, store the machine out of reach of children. This machine is not intended for use by persons (including children) with reduced physical, sensory or mental capabilities, or lack of experience and knowledge, unless they have been given supervision or instruction con- cerning use of the machine by a per- son responsible for their safety. Children should be supervised to en- sure that they do not play with the machine. Never work while people, especially children, or pets are nearby. Never operate the trimmer with miss- ing or broken guards or shields or without guards or shields in position. Before use check the supply and ex- tension cord for signs of damage or ageing. If the cord becomes damaged during use, disconnect the cord from the supply immediately. DO NOT

TOUCH THE CORD BEFORE DISCON-

NECTING THE SUPPLY. Do not use the trimmer if the cord is damaged or worn. Before using the machine and after impact, check for signs of wear or damage and repair if necessary. Never operate the product when you are tired, ill or under the influence of alcohol, drugs or medicine. Always wear long heavy trousers, boots and gloves. Do not wear loose clothing, jewellery, short trousers, sandals and never work barefoot. Wear safety eye protection and ear defenders when operating the ma- chine. Keep firm footing and balance. Do not overreach. Never work with this trimmer while people, especially children or pets are nearby. Wait until the cutting head has com- pletely stopped before touching it. The head continues to rotate after the trimmer is switched off, the cutting system can cause injury/damage. Work only in daylight or in good artifi- cial light. Avoid operating the trimmer in bad weather conditions especially when there is a risk of lightning. Operating the trimmer in wet grass decreases the efficiency of perfor- mance. Switch off when transporting the trimmer to and from the area to be worked on. Switch on the trimmer with hands and feet well away from the rotating line. Caution – do not touch rotating cutting line. Do not put hands or feet near the cut- ting system. Never fit metal cutting elements to this trimmer. Inspect and maintain the trimmer regularly. Have the trimmer repaired only by an authorized customer service agent. Always ensure that the ventilation slots are kept clear of debris. Take care against injury from the blade fitted for cutting the nylon line length. After feeding line always re- turn the trimmer to its horizontal op- erating position before switching on. Switch off and remove the plug from the socket: – whenever you leave the machine unattended for any period – before replacing the cutting line – if the cable is tangled, – before cleaning or working on the trimmer After use, disconnect the machine from the mains and check for dam- age. Store the machine in a secure, dry place out of the reach of children. Do not place other objects on top of the machine. Replace worn or damaged parts for safety. Ensure replacement parts fitted are Bosch-approved. Do not operate the machine with- out the trimmer attachment fitted. Electrical Safety Warning! Switch off, remove plug from mains before adjusting, cleaning or if cable is cut, damaged or entangled. Your machine is double insulated for safety and requires no earth connec- tion. The operating voltage is 230 V AC, 50 Hz (for non-EU countries 220 V, 240 V as applicable). Only use ap- proved extension cables. Contact your Bosch Service Centre for details. For increased electrical safety use a Re- sidual Current Device (RCD) with a trip- ping current of not more than 30 mA. Always check your RCD every time you use it. The connections (plugs and sockets) should be kept dry and off the ground. The supply cables must be inspected for signs of damage at regular intervals and may only be used if in perfect con- dition. If the supply cable on the product is damaged, it must only be replaced by a Bosch Service Centre. Only use approved extension cables. Extension cords, cables, leads, reels should only be used if they comply with EN 61242/IEC 61242 or IEC 60884-2-7. If you want to use an extension cable when operating your product, only the following cable dimensions should be used: – Nominal Conductor Area of

– Maximum length of 30 m for a Cord Extension Set or maximum length of 60 m for a Cable Reel with Residual Current Device (RCD Note: If an extension cable is used it must be earthed and connected through the plug to the earth cable of your supply network in accordance with prescribed safety regulations. If in doubt contact a qualified electri- cian or the nearest Bosch Service Cen- tre. WARNING! Inadequate exten- sion cables can be dangerous. Extension cable, plug and socket must be of watertight con- struction and intended for outdoor use. For products not sold in GB:

Products sold in GB only: Your prod- uct is fitted with a BS 1363/A ap- proved electric plug with internal fuse (ASTA approved to BS 1362). If the plug is not suitable for your socket outlets, it should be cut off and an appropriate plug fitted in its place by an authorised customer ser- vice agent. The replacement plug should have the same fuse rating as the original plug. The severed plug must be disposed of to avoid a possible shock hazard and should never be inserted into a mains socket elsewhere. Products sold in AUS and NZ only: Use a residual current device (RCD) with a rated residual current of 30 mA or less. Mounting and Operation Do not connect the machine to the mains socket before it is completely assembled. The cutting line continues to rotate for a few seconds after the trimmer is switched off. Allow the motor/cut- ting line to stop rotating before switching “on” again. Do not rapidly switch off and on. Do not hand bump the line feed as it could be hot. Remove any grass from spool cover when changing line or spool. Only use Bosch approved cutting elements. Cutting performance will vary with different cutting elements. Use the original spring when replacing spool.
